Problem
Deep learning models operate as black boxes, making it difficult to explain their functionality, especially in critical scenarios, and lack transparency, which can lead to costly failures and ethical concerns due to uninterpretable biases.
Innovation Solution
A system and method that uses rule-set evolution to generate transparent rule-set models equivalent to deep learning models, allowing for the evaluation and evolution of these models to provide explainability and replicate their performance in real-world problems.

A system and method for adding explainability to deep learning models based on rule-set evolution is provided. A set of inputs from an input unit is received which comprises pre-generated deep learning models. Set of inputs is evaluated using pre-defined querying datasets. An output comprising outcomes of the evaluation is generated and mapped with each of the pre-defined querying datasets used for querying deep learning model. A new dataset is generated based on the mapping. Population of initial rule-set models is randomly generated based on a set of hyper parameters. The hyper parameters relate to configuration parameters used for generating population of initial rule-set models. An evolution process is carried out on generated rule-set models for evolving the rule-set models by using the generated new datasets. Lastly, the evolved rule-set model is executed to solve one or more real-world problems.
